Patsy Shields
Patsy Shields travels both nationally and internationally teaching others how to have fun with their sewing machines. She has written for several sewing publications, has projects in several books and has produced a video on ribbon embroidery by machine. She also teaches at consumer sewing events around the country and has a wealth of knowledge about threads, stabilizers, and machine embroidery.
